I'm a new Master Combat and I'm looking for advice on what most people experiment in when making Poison/Disease C's for PvP purposes. It seems experiementing in "Ease of Use' actually effects potency for poisons, so for example should I experiment in 'ease of use' to ensure potency exceeds 100 (which I understand is cannot be resisted) ?
Also the experimenting in 'charges' seems to increase the range, is this really worth experimenting past say 30m ?
Any advice you can give will be appreciated.

if your stuff is good enough, you can hit 45+meters by experimenting in charges. No bug, no exploit. That equates to a 90m thrown pack, albeit with a pretty crappy effectiveness..
Experimenting on the bottom one (name eludes me atm) will affect the effectiveness (and the area affected on an AE pack).

Bottom = Effectiveness... That is the one that I always expirement in.. If you want more charges then you should try to get some rancor bile instead of using dispersal mechinisms.
